Curtiss-Wright Corporation Enterprise Value to EBITDA (EV/EBITDA) on June 03, 2024: 19.67

Curtiss-Wright Corporation Enterprise Value to EBITDA (EV/EBITDA) is 19.67 on June 03, 2024, a 33.63% change year over year. The EV/EBITDA ratio compares a company's enterprise value to its EBITDA. It provides insight into the company's valuation relative to its earnings and is commonly used in comparing the relative value of different companies within an industry. A lower ratio suggests a potentially more favorable valuation.
  • Curtiss-Wright Corporation 52-week high Enterprise Value to EBITDA (EV/EBITDA) is 20.05 on February 15, 2024, which is 1.88% above the current Enterprise Value to EBITDA (EV/EBITDA).
  • Curtiss-Wright Corporation 52-week low Enterprise Value to EBITDA (EV/EBITDA) is 14.32 on July 03, 2023, which is -27.20% below the current Enterprise Value to EBITDA (EV/EBITDA).
  • Curtiss-Wright Corporation average Enterprise Value to EBITDA (EV/EBITDA) for the last 52 weeks is 17.56.

Description

Curtiss-Wright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, provides engineered products, solutions, and services mainly to aerospace and defense, commercial power, process, and industrial markets worldwide. It operates through three segments: Aerospace & Industrial, Defense Electronics, and Naval & Power. The Aerospace & Industrial segment offers industrial and specialty vehicle products, such as power management electronics, traction inverters, transmission shifters, and control systems; sensors, controls, and electro-mechanical actuation components used on commercial and military aircraft; and surface technology services including shot peening, laser peening, and engineered coatings. The Defense Electronics segment provides commercial off-the-shelf embedded computing board-level modules and processing equipment, data acquisition and flight test instrumentation equipment, integrated subsystems, instrumentation and control systems, tactical communications solutions; and electronic stabilization products, and weapons handling systems; avionics and electronics; flight test equipment; and aircraft data management solutions. The Naval & Power segment offers main coolant pumps, power-dense compact motors, generators, steam turbines, valves, and secondary propulsion systems; energy absorbers, retractable hook cable systems, net-stanchion systems and mobile systems to support fixed land-based arresting systems; hardware, valves, fastening systems, specialized containment doors, airlock hatches, and spent fuel management products; reactor coolant pumps and control rod drive mechanisms for commercial nuclear power plants, as well as various nuclear reactor technologies. This segment furnishes severe-service valve technologies and services, heat exchanger repair, and piping test and isolation products, and offers ship repair and maintenance for the U.S. navy. Curtiss-Wright Corporation was incorporated in 1929 and is headquartered in Davidson, North Carolina.
